Problems solved by technology

During positioning, when the position of the camera changes, the positioning of the conveyor belt will fail, resulting in missed detection
In addition, when sorting, the number of defective chain conveyor belts is much less than that of non-defective chain conveyor belts. Insufficient sample number of defective chain conveyor belts will cause the computer to fail to identify defects such as cracks, protruding parts, and sunken parts. Conveyor belt, resulting in missed detection
[0003] To sum up, at this stage, the chain conveyor belt defect detection based on human eyes and the chain conveyor belt defect detection based on machine vision are prone to missed detection of defects such as cracks, scratches, and protruding parts.

Abstract

The invention discloses a chain type conveyor belt defect detection method based on image processing, and relates to the technical field of cigarette production. According to the invention, the methodcomprises the steps of erecting a camera on the side surface of a to-be-detected chain type conveyor belt, then collecting a real-time image of the chain type conveying belt through the camera; carrying out the scale scaling on the image through a Gaussian scale pyramid; using a pre-constructed multi-angle rotation model to position the image after scale scaling, obtaining the chain conveyor beltregions, converting the area of the chain conveyor belt into a grayscale image through differential multi-core Gaussian filtering, and filtering the grayscale image; enhancing the detection area of the chain type conveying belt by using the index change; carrying out image segmentation on the enhanced image, selecting and counting the characteristics of a defect-free chain type conveyor belt, andfinally comparing the characteristics of the defect-free chain type conveyor belt counted in advance with the corresponding characteristics of the chain type conveyor belt in an image collected in real time to judge whether the chain type conveyor belt has defects or not.

technical field [0001] The invention relates to the technical field of cigarette production, in particular to a defect detection method for chain conveyor belts based on image processing. Background technique [0002] The defect detection of chain conveyor belt is mainly divided into two types: defect detection based on human eyes and defect detection based on machine vision. Among them, the defect detection based on human eyes is realized by observing the chain conveyor belt with human eyes. If the length of the chain conveyor belt is too long, the sampling personnel will have visual fatigue, which will easily cause the defects of the chain conveyor belt to be missed. In addition, the sampling personnel Generally, the chain is regularly inspected, and the chain cannot be monitored in real time.
